Greetings.
Doe anyone have a direct way (or a work-around)to play a song with your best-so-far-Style and then use the Style Picker repeatedly to keep choosing from similar styles to your best-so-far-Style (which have an ask asterisk or caret when you best-so-far-Style is set as the Prototype). The problem is that each time you preview a style from the Style Picker with a double-click that new style now becomes the Prototype style so that before you can try other styles similar to your best-so-far-Style you must re-choose your best-so-far-Style. The idea is to be able to relatively quickly compare your best-so-far-Style with other styles that are close in style to it (i.e those with asterisk or carets beside them when your best-so-far-Style is the Prototype) without having to rechoose your best-so-far-Style to get back to the list of similar styles to your best-so-far-Style.

Inside the Stylepicker window, at the bottom area, is a checkbox, "Audition on Doubleclick" that I often use to audition styles without having to close the Stylepicker window at all.
don't like the one you doubleclicked, simply doubleclick another. Helps to first check the Loop box in the main window such that the song will keep repeating.

If your chosen original style has been replaced, relax, remember that the song was Saved (or should have been) with the original Style as part of the file. Merely closing the songfile and reselecting it with Open (without saving the closed one) will open it up again with the original style in place.

Absolutely !!

With your best-so-far style chosen, click the "prototype" button to make it the default style. Then click on the "if feel and tempo match" box selection. Make sure the style list (left hand side) is set to "all styles." That should narrow down all of the biab styles that have the same feel and tempo as your best-so-far style. You can go down the list (right hand side) and demo each one until you find a bestest-so-far style.

Or,

Make a hybrid out of the right hand side list selection of styles.

If, after auditioning numerous styles you wish to reselect the original style, you can either remember what that style was, or, as Mac suggests, reload the song which will, presumably, have the original style.

But this isn't usually the situation for me. I want to audition styles to find the one I like best. So I start going through styles, don't like the first three, but the forth is really good. But now I'm asking if I'll like the next styles better, so I go on and audition more 12 more. At some point I decide I want to compare the forth and tenth and original style. Now I have a problem.

What I do is use the "favorites" feature in the StylePicker. After clearing it out at the beginning of the session, I make the original and subsequent styles I like a "Favorite". When I'm ready I click "Only Show Favorites" and I have a short list I can work from, including the original.

I would like BIAB (and have made a Wish List request) to create a list for each StylePicker session that would work like this.

Thanks everybody for your help! One way to do what I want is to play my song with my best-so-far-Style. Then open the style picker and choose the "Play" button (top middle of the Style Picker). I can choose whatever style I want but my best-so-far-Style remains the Prototype and so it keeps determining which other styles will get a * or ^ ranking.
